It has been revealed that Tom Burke, who played the role of the guard captain Jack in “Mad Max: Furiosa” (2024), will be taking part in “Blade Runner 2099”, the first drama series of the sci-fi masterpiece “Blade Runner” series. Deadline reports.

The limited series “Blade Runner 2099,” which is scheduled to be distributed worldwide on Amazon Prime Video, serves as a sequel to “Blade Runner” (1982) and “Blade Runner 2049” (2017), and will tell a story consisting of 10 episodes set in the year 2099, 50 years after the second film.

Details such as the plot are unknown, and the character Burke will play has not been revealed. Burke, who is from the UK, is an actor who gained attention for his role as Athos, one of the three musketeers in the British drama “The Musketeers” (2014-2016) for three seasons. He played the role of legendary actor Orson Welles in David Fincher's biopic “Mank”, and has also appeared in “The Lazarus Project” (2022-2023) and the British remake of Akira Kurosawa's “Ikiru” (1952) “Living” (2022).

In addition to Burke, new cast members include Michelle Yeoh, who won the Academy Award for Best Actress for Everything Everywhere All at Once, and Hunter Schafer. Maurizio Lombardi from Stay Home (2019) was also revealed to be appearing. Others include Dimitri Avold from Sub Addict (2022) and Gregory D. Wilson from Get Ducated! Other cast members already confirmed for the film include Lewis Gribben from The Princess (2020), Caitlin Rose Downey from The Princess (2022), Daniel Rigby from The Black Panthers (2021), Johnny Harris from Snow White (2012), Amy Lennox from Cry Moly (2012), Sheila Atim from The Woman King (2022), and Matthew Needham from House of the Dragon (2022-).

Ridley Scott, who worked on “Blade Runner,” Michael Green, the screenwriter of “Blade Runner 2049,” and producer Cynthia Yorkin are executive producers. Showrunner, executive producer, and scriptwriter will be up-and-coming artist Silka Luisa of Apple TV+'s “Shining Girl,” and Jonathan Van Tulken of “SHOGUN” (2024-) will be the director of the first and second episodes.

“Blade Runner 2099” is currently being filmed in Prague. A release date has yet to be determined.
